在当今信息技术飞速发展的时代,软件开发已成为支撑现代科技与人文社会发展的基石之一。26套TPO阅读主题索引[归类].pdf虽然未直接探讨软件开发的具体技术细节,但它所涉及的各类学科主题却隐含了软件技术的应用与需求。通过深入分析这些主题,我们不难发现,软件开发实际上是连接自然科学、生物科学、社会科学及人文艺术等领域与现代技术的桥梁。
在自然科学的诸多分支中,地质学与天文学的研究往往需要依赖于先进的软件工具。例如,冰川形成、地下水分布、沙漠演变等现象的深入研究,常常依赖于地理信息系统(GIS)来实现对地理数据的空间分析和模拟。GIS软件能够在复杂的地理信息中提取有用信息,并以直观的图表形式展示出来,这对于地质学研究具有极高的价值。同样,对于天文学而言,研究者们在探索宇宙奥秘时,通过软件进行的天文数据处理和三维可视化技术,能够使复杂的天文现象变得可视化,辅助研究者做出更加精确的观测与分析。
在生物科学的探究中,生物信息学的应用同样离不开软件开发的支持。植物学与动物学领域的研究往往需要处理大量的基因序列数据,这不仅涉及到数据的存储,还需要分析和处理算法,如进化树构建、蛋白质结构预测等。生态学与环境科学的研究,尤其是生态系统稳定性与气候变化影响的预测,也常常借助计算机模拟软件来实现。这些软件可以模拟不同因素对生态系统的影响,帮助科学家们更好地理解环境变化的潜在影响。
社会科学与人文艺术领域的研究,虽然与传统意义上的软件开发看似相距甚远,但在当今数字化、信息化的时代背景下,数字技术已经深度参与到艺术创作与传播的各个环节中。无论是数字图像处理技术在艺术史研究中的应用,还是3D建模软件在建筑设计中的运用,或是影视后期特效制作在电影产业中的重要性,它们都昭示着软件开发在创意产业中的不可或缺。
历史学与考古学领域的研究,在数字化技术的帮助下,能够将历史资料与实物以数字化的形式保存下来,并通过模拟软件重现历史情境,甚至对某些历史事件进行推演。这不仅有助于历史知识的普及,也为历史研究带来了全新的视角和方法。考古学中,对于古文化遗址的研究,通过三维扫描和数据重建技术,能够虚拟地重现遗址的历史面貌,这对于文化遗产的保护与传播具有重要意义。
尽管26套TPO阅读主题索引[归类].pdf文件中未直接涉及软件开发的专业知识,但通过对这些主题的深入分析,我们能够清晰地看到软件开发是如何在不同学科领域中发挥关键作用的。这些跨学科的联系不仅揭示了软件开发在技术层面的广泛应用,同时也强调了软件开发者对于其他学科知识背景的理解和应用的重要性。开发者只有对相关领域有了足够的了解,才能开发出更贴合用户需求、更符合实际应用场景的软件工具,从而推动科技与社会的共同进步。